Tenants Purchase Scheme Phase 4 Launched

The following is issued on behalf of the Housing Authority:

With the launch of Tenants Purchase Scheme (TPS) Phase 4 today (February 14), a golden opportunity is now open to public housing tenants living in six estates to buy their rental flats at attractive prices.

The six estates are Lower Wong Tai Sin 1, Tsing Yi, Hing Tin in Lam Tin, Kwong Yuen in Shatin, King Lam in Tseung Kwan O and Leung King in Tuen Mun. A total of 26 414 rental flats are put up for sale. With the first-year full credit, 98% of the flats are priced below $300,000, while the average selling price is only $170,000.

"TPS enables tenants to own the home they have been living in for years, helping them to keep the community ties in a familiar neighbourhood," noted Chairman of the Housing Authority's Home Ownership Committee, Mr. Walter Chan Kar-lok, while officiating at today's launching ceremony.

"When they become owners, they will have more say on estate management and a stronger incentive to improve the environment," he said.

Over 56 000 families have joined the rank of home owners through TPS since its introduction in 1998. For TPS Phase 3, over 70 % of the tenants have submitted their applications for purchase, and about 64 % have already completed the assignments.

Letters have been sent out to invite eligible tenants to pick up the Letter of Offer and sales brochures from designated locations. For more information, tenants can visit the exhibition booths or contact the TPS staff at the six estates.
